In the last decade,... WebThe WHO estimates that more than 8 million people die prematurely due to tobacco use each year. This is the latest available WHO estimate as of June 2024. More than 7 million of those deaths are the result of direct tobacco use. About 1.2 million are non-smokers …

According … cannot instantiate the type vehicleWebTobacco caused an estimated 125,000 deaths in the UK in 2024 - around a fifth (20%) of all deaths from all causes, that’s around one person every five minutes . [ 2] It caused an estimated 55,000 cancer deaths in the UK in 2024 - more than a quarter (28%) of all cancer deaths.
